We’re Civica and we make software that helps deliver critical services for citizens all around the world. From local government to central (federal) government, to education, to health and care, over 5,000 public bodies across the globe use our software to help provide critical services to over 100 million citizens.

Our aspiration is to be a GovTech champion everywhere we work around the globe, supporting the needs of citizens and those that serve them every day. Building on 21 years of continuous growth and success, we’re at a pivotal point on our journey to realise that aspiration.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Strategic relationship building: Develop and maintain strong, long-term relationships with key decision-makers at the C-level in UK local government. Understand their business objectives, pain points, and operational needs to position our software solutions effectively.
  • Account management: Take ownership of assigned large/sensitive or critical local government accounts, serving as the primary point of contact for C-level contacts. Develop a deep understanding of the customer’s business landscape, ensuring customer satisfaction, retention, and identifying opportunities for upselling and cross-selling.
  • Revenue growth: Deliver revenue growth within an assigned territory through strategic deal closure and/or opening opportunities that are passed to the Line-of-Business sales team to close.
  • Drive holistic account cadence: Ensure a robust and holistic account management cadence both with the customer and internally. Conduct regular meetings with the customer to review progress, address challenges, and identify new opportunities for collaboration.
  • Ownership of new business demand generation: Collaborate with marketing and sales enablement to create targeted campaigns and initiatives to generate demand for our software solutions.
  • Strategic planning: Formulate account-specific strategic plans to achieve revenue and growth targets. Continuously monitor progress, adjust strategies as needed, and report on key performance indicators.
  • Trusted advisor and reliability: Serve as a responsive and reliable point of contact for C-level leaders, providing guidance and support in navigating the challenges of the public sector.
  • Innovative approaches: Introduce challenging topics and alternative ways of working with peers to explore innovative approaches or resolutions to complex problems.
